The Relationships, Sex and Health Education (RSHE) statutory guidance states that, in both primary and secondary school, pupils should be taught the facts regarding legal and illegal harmful substances and associated risks, including smoking, alcohol use, and drug taking.<\/p>
To support schools to deliver this content effectively, the Department published a suite of teacher training modules, including content on drugs, alcohol and tobacco, which makes specific reference to e-cigarettes.<\/p>
In addition, content on drugs, alcohol and tobacco is taught in compulsory health education. This supplements drug education which is part of the national curriculum for science in Key Stages 2 and 3.<\/p>
Schools are required by law to have a behaviour policy that sets out what is expected of all pupils, including what items are banned from school premises. This should be communicated to all pupils, parents and school staff.<\/p>
